What is the 500 Calorie Diet:
The 500 Calorie Diet is an extreme form of a very low calorie diet. Includes meal replacement drinks, shakes and cereal bars for at least two meals a day. This restricted calorie consumption will help your body utilize the stored fuel source, ie fat. And in turn, you will lose weight quickly.
But make sure you only do it if you have a very high BMI or if your doctor has recommended it. Also, this type of intermittent fasting should be done under the supervision of your doctor or nutritionist. But how will it benefit you? Find out below.
Benefits of the 500 Calorie Diet:
The main benefit of the 500 Calorie Diet is that it helps in rapid weight loss . A calorie deficit of 3500 calories can help you shed a pound of flab. If your normal diet contains around 2000 calories a day, the 500 calorie plan can create a deficit of around 1500 calories right away!
Also, if you follow this for two days, you will lose weight. It’s great for those who need to lose weight quickly to avoid health risks. So what should your 500 Calorie Diet plan look like ? Find out below.

Risks of the 500 Calorie Diet for Health:
Check out the main risks that the 500 Calorie Diet can cause:
Muscle Loss:
Do you want to lose weight ? So, lose the fat, not the muscle. Also, if you are on a VLCD for an extended period, you will start to lose muscle mass, which will give you a “skinny” appearance. This means you will be thin, but your skin will be loose and saggy.
Nutritional Deficiency :
Since you won’t be consuming a lot of calories, after a certain point your body will run out of micronutrients that are essential for it to function properly.
Metabolic Changes:
When you lose muscle mass and important nutrients, your metabolism will slow down, leading to weight gain instead of weight loss .
- It can lead to eating disorders. Eating less will change your body’s functions, which can cause long-term damage.
